Myeloproliferative Disorders Drugs/Treatment Market size was valued at USD 9.3 billion in 2023 and is expected to grow at a CAGR of 3.2% between 2024 and 2032. The market is experiencing significant growth due to the availability of novel drugs and a robust pipeline that has broadened the treatment options and stimulated innovation for rare disease treatment. Additionally, the rising incidence of myeloproliferative disorders, attributed to an aging population, changing lifestyles, and increased public awareness, further boosts market growth.

For instance, the Surveillance, Epidemiology, and End Results (SEER) program of the National Cancer Institute estimates that approximately 20,000 people are diagnosed with a myeloproliferative neoplasm (MPN) each year in the U.S., with around 295,000 people living with an MPN. Moreover, the growing awareness about MPDs among both patients and healthcare providers is leading to early diagnosis and treatment, driving market growth.

Myeloproliferative disorder treatment refers to therapeutic interventions designed to manage and mitigate the symptoms and progression of myeloproliferative disorders, a group of rare haematological conditions characterized by the overproduction of blood cells in the bone marrow.

Based on the disorder type, the market is categorized into Philadelphia chromosome-positive (Ph+) chronic myeloid leukemia (CML), Philadelphia chromosome-negative (Ph-) my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PNs), and other disorder types. The Ph-MPNs are further classified as polycythemia vera, essential thrombocythemia, and myelofibrosis. The Ph-MPNs segment held over 91.7% of the market share in 2023.

Based on drug class, the myeloproliferative disorders drugs/treatment market is classified into tyrosine kinase inhibitors, Janus kinase (JAK) inhibitors, hydroxyurea, and other drug classes. The JAK inhibitors segment is anticipated to witness high growth at a CAGR of 3.1% through 2032.
Based on the route of administration, the myeloproliferative disorders drugs/treatment market is classified into oral and injectable. The oral route segment is projected to cross USD 10.1 billion by 2032.
Based on the end-use, the myeloproliferative disorders drugs/treatment market is classified into hospitals, specialty clinics, and other end-users. Hospital segment dominated around USD 4.6 billion revenue in 2023.

North America dominated the global myeloproliferative disorders drugs/treatment market accounted for 41.9% of the market share in 2023.
